CHANGE IN REGISTRANT'S CERTIFYING ACCOUNTANTS The Registrant's certifying accountant, Weber & Company, P.C. has ceased operations as a separate entity effective December 31, 2001, in conjunction with the forming a new entity, Epstein, Weber & Conover, P.L.C., Certified Public Accountants. The registrant has engaged the new entity, Epstein, Weber & Conover, P.L.C., Certified Public Accountants as its auditors. Weber & Company, P. C. issued its unqualified opinion on the registrant's financial statements dated December 20, 2001, as of and for the year ended September 30, 2001. During the Registrant's two most recent fiscal years ended September 30, 2001, and interim periods, there were no disagreements with Weber & Company, P.C. with respect to matters of accounting principles or practices, financial statement disclosure, or auditing scope or procedures which, if not resolved to Weber & Company, P.L.C. satisfaction would have caused Weber & Company, P.L.C. to make reference to the subject matter of the disagreement in connection with its reports on the Registrant's consolidated financial statements for such years. Weber & Company, P.C. has not advised the registrant of the matters outlined in Item 304 (a)(1)(iv)(B) of Regulation S-B with respect to internal accounting controls, management representations, scope of the audit and material matters coming to their attention that would impact the financial statements and their audit report for the Registrant's two most recent fiscal years ended September 30, 2001 and interim periods. Prior to engaging Epstein, Weber & Conover, PLC, the registrant had not consulted with them on the application of accounting principles to a specified transaction, either completed or proposed; or the type of audit opinion that might be rendered on the registrant's financial statements.
